A. Prices

1. Prices are based on known costs as at 1st April 2002.
2. What the price includes is specifically stated in our brochures and leaflets.
3. Tour Prices quoted do not include accommodation, food, fares to /from your pick up/ drop off point, drinks, snacks, entrance fees/ personal items.
4. Road Trip operates a kitty system and this must be paid on the day of departure to the tour host in CASH. The tour kitty prices varied from tour to tour - for up top date prices please see link from the website or ask staff for details. The Kitty will include Accommodation based on standard mixed rooms, Breakfasts, some evening meals and some entrance fees.

D. Cancellation of bookings and refunds
1. If you have to cancel your booking you must notify us immediately.
2. By making a Road Trip booking you are also guaranteeing to cover the cost of the Road Trip Kitty cost for each member booked on the Trip. 3. Cancellations are validated only when acknowledge by Road Trip (either by verbal agreement or in writing) in the form of a cancellation reference number.
Notice of cancellation and cancellation costs, to which the party is responsible for, who booked the tour is as follows;
More than one week Up to 50 % at discretion
Less than one week 90%
Less than 48 hours 100%
4. We shall not make refunds in any other circumstances. In particular, no refund will be made after the scheduled date or time of departure. Missed departures shall be treated as cancellations. We cannot be responsible for failure of public transport or traffic delays, which may prevent you from taking the tour. We shall try to accommodate you on another tour (subject to availability and a 50 percent surcharge).
